Teach us the Bible is a solid children's curriculum. I recently reviewed it and here are some of the things that stood out to me.
- It is grounded in childhood development principles.
- It's designed for today's technology. Lessons are available to download online. Teachers can print lessons ahead of time or simply access them on their iPad or laptop during class.
- 104 (2 years) of chronological Bible story lessons.
- 1 year through the Old Testament and 1 year through the New Testament.
- Meaningful activities that reinforce the lesson.
- Children get each lesson 3 times by the end of 5th grade.
- Students learn a new Bible verse every 4 weeks.
- Each lesson includes supplies and preparation steps, as well as coloring sheets that will get your kids excited.
- Teachers use Children's Storybook Bibles to make sure lessons are comprehended.
